29365 Zip Code

April 18, 2024

Zip Code: 29365
City/Town: Lyman
State: South Carolina
Population: 10,146
Per Capita Income: $23,544
Mean Household Income: $58,526
Total Housing Units: 3,885
Median Home Value: $88,900
Median Year Homes Built: 1976
Land Area: 18.3 sq miles
47.3 sq kilometers
Water Area: 0.7 sq miles
1.9 sq kilometers
